Blue light is scattered more than the other colors because it travels as shorter, smaller waves The color of the sky is a beautiful result of how sunlight interacts with the atmosphere This is why we see a blue sky most of the time.

So, in short, the sky is blue because of rayleigh scattering, which causes shorter blue wavelengths of light to scatter more than other colors Our eyes are tuned to see blue more clearly, and the sun emits more blue than violet light, which is why our daytime sky isn’t purple. The blue color results from rayleigh scattering, where shorter (blue) wavelengths of sunlight scatter more than longer (red) wavelengths in earth’s atmosphere. The sky looks blue because of a process called rayleigh scattering This happens when sunlight hits tiny gas molecules in earth’s atmosphere, and the shorter blue light waves get scattered more than the other colors.
